    Overview of Costa Rica's Electrical System

    History and Evolution

    The electrical infrastructure in Costa Rica has undergone remarkable advancements since its inception in the early 20th century. Today, the country boasts one of the most dependable power grids in Central America, managed primarily by the Instituto Costarricense de Electricidad (ICE). This state-owned utility company ensures consistent and reliable electricity distribution throughout the nation.

    In recent decades, Costa Rica has embraced renewable energy sources, with hydroelectric power playing a pivotal role in its energy mix. This commitment to sustainability has positioned the country as a global leader in eco-friendly energy production, further enhancing its reputation as a forward-thinking nation.

    Common Plug Types in Costa Rica

    Travelers to Costa Rica will encounter two primary plug types: Type A and Type B. These are identical to the plug types used in the United States and many other countries, making it relatively easy for visitors to adapt their devices.

    • Type A: This plug features two flat prongs and is commonly used for small electronics like smartphones, cameras, and other portable devices.
    • Type B: Featuring two flat prongs and a grounding pin, Type B is often required for larger electronics such as laptops, hairdryers, and other high-powered appliances.

    Understanding Voltage Standards

    Costa Rica operates on a standard voltage of 110V, similar to the United States and Canada. While this voltage is compatible with most modern devices, slight variations can occur in certain areas, so it’s wise to verify compatibility before traveling.

    Compatibility with International Standards

    Although 110V is standard in Costa Rica, many countries use 220V or 240V. If you’re traveling from a region with higher voltage standards, you may need both a voltage converter and a plug adapter to ensure your devices function correctly.

    When to Use Voltage Converters

    While many contemporary devices are dual-voltage and capable of handling both 110V and 220V, some appliances may require a voltage converter. Below are scenarios where a converter is necessary:

    • Single-voltage appliances from countries with 220V or 240V standards, such as hairdryers or electric kettles, may not function without a converter.
    • High-wattage devices often benefit from the use of a converter to prevent damage caused by voltage mismatches.

    Frequently Asked Questions

    Can I Use My Electronics Without an Adapter?

    If your devices are dual-voltage and equipped with Type A or Type B plugs, you may not need an adapter. However, it’s always prudent to carry one, particularly for larger appliances, to avoid unexpected complications.

    Are Voltage Converters Necessary for Laptops?

    Most laptops are designed to handle both 110V and 220V, so a voltage converter is typically unnecessary. Nevertheless, always review your device’s specifications to confirm compatibility.

    Insights into Costa Rica's Electrical Infrastructure

    Costa Rica’s electrical infrastructure is robust, with over 99% of its population having access to electricity. According to the World Bank, approximately 99% of the country’s electricity is generated from renewable sources, primarily hydroelectric power, underscoring its commitment to sustainable energy practices.

    Reliability of Power Supply

    The Instituto Costarricense de Electricidad (ICE) ensures a stable and reliable power supply across the nation. While power outages are infrequent, it’s wise to carry a backup power source, especially when traveling to remote or rural areas.
